**Hospital of the University of Pennsylvania (HUP): A Flagship Institution**

The Hospital of the University of Pennsylvania (HUP), located in West Philadelphia but easily accessible from 19115, is a major player in the region's healthcare landscape. HUP consistently receives high marks for its comprehensive cancer care. While specific prostate cancer survival rates are not always publicly available at the hospital level, HUP's overall cancer program is well-regarded. HUP is a National Cancer Institute (NCI)-designated Comprehensive Cancer Center, a prestigious designation that indicates a commitment to cutting-edge research and treatment. HUP's urology department boasts a large team of specialists, including fellowship-trained urologic oncologists specializing in prostate cancer. The hospital offers a full spectrum of treatment options, including robotic-assisted surgery (da Vinci), radiation therapy (including brachytherapy), and advanced medical oncology. HUP’s ER wait times can vary, but patients should expect to be seen relatively quickly given the hospital’s size and resources. HUP has a 4-star CMS rating. Telehealth services are available, with increasing utilization since the pandemic.

**Fox Chase Cancer Center: A Dedicated Cancer Center**

Fox Chase Cancer Center, also easily accessible from 19115, is a dedicated cancer center with a national reputation. Fox Chase focuses exclusively on cancer care, including prostate cancer. This specialization allows for a high degree of expertise and access to the latest treatment protocols. Fox Chase is also an NCI-designated Comprehensive Cancer Center. Prostate cancer patients benefit from a multidisciplinary approach, with teams of urologists, radiation oncologists, medical oncologists, and other specialists collaborating on individualized treatment plans. Fox Chase offers advanced imaging technologies, including MRI and PET scans, for accurate diagnosis and staging. The center is at the forefront of clinical trials, providing patients with access to innovative therapies. Fox Chase generally has shorter ER wait times compared to larger general hospitals, given its focus. Fox Chase also has a strong telehealth program, particularly for follow-up appointments and consultations.

**Key Metrics to Consider**

When choosing a hospital for prostate cancer care, several factors are crucial:

* **Expertise:** Look for hospitals with experienced urologists, radiation oncologists, and medical oncologists specializing in prostate cancer.
* **Technology:** Access to advanced imaging, robotic surgery, and radiation therapy techniques is essential.
* **Multidisciplinary Approach:** A team-based approach, involving multiple specialists, is often beneficial.
* **Clinical Trials:** Access to clinical trials can provide access to innovative therapies.
* **Patient Satisfaction:** Consider patient reviews and satisfaction scores.
* **Accessibility:** Consider the hospital's location, parking, and ease of access.
* **Insurance Coverage:** Confirm that the hospital accepts your insurance plan.

**CMS Star Ratings: A General Indicator**

The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services (CMS) provides star ratings for hospitals based on quality measures. These ratings can be a helpful, though not definitive, indicator of hospital performance. However, it is important to note that these ratings are a general overview and may not reflect the quality of care specifically for prostate cancer.
